iPhone Air 2 Rumors: Dual Camera, Better Battery, Spring 2027 Release?! (2026)

The iPhone Air 2 is reportedly set to make its debut in the spring of 2027, marking a significant shift in Apple's product launch strategy. A Second Camera, Improved Battery Life, and a New Processor

According to Mark Gurman at Bloomberg, the iPhone Air 2 could feature a second rear camera, improved battery life, and a version of the A20 Pro processor. These upgrades are significant, as they directly address some of the perceived shortcomings of the original iPhone Air. The solitary rear camera was a notable drawback in our review, so adding a second camera could be a game-changer for those seeking enhanced photography capabilities in a slim device. A Shift in Apple's Product Launch Strategy

The idea of a spring release for the iPhone Air 2 aligns with Apple's recent shift in its product launch strategy. Previously, all iPhone announcements came in the fall, but within the past 12 months, Apple has focused on its pricier models in September and pushed the budget iPhone 17e to the spring. This change suggests Apple is rethinking its approach to smaller smartphones, having previously abandoned efforts like the iPhone mini and iPhone SE.
